Yeah its like 77, just stronger. Works great, no mess and all the goopy stuff. Its also nice that it sticks when you lay it up....that way you can do a little at a time and not have to worry about it flopping over on the vertical surfaces. Are you headed to Eufaula? Glad yall like it.:) We put her in at a little lake about 20 miles SE of Lindsay called Clear Creek Lake. It's a tiny lake out in the boonies and it's so small that everybody has to go counter-clockwise around it, but it's close and good enough for a sea trial. I love the bucket seats. It's nice to be able to swivel around and kick your feet up on the beach seat when you're just chillin, and the spotter can face backwards when pulling a skier. I sure like the sound of that thru hull exhaust too. The boat seems lighter, more nimble, quicker to plane, and sits higher in the water. Before the resto, if i had passengers in the rear and nobody in the bow, it took forever to plane. Yesterday, I had two passengers in the back and absolutely no weight in the bow, and it planed out in a couple seconds. I'm very happy about that. One big deal to me was that there wasn't even a drop in the bilge! Didn't even need to pull the plug when we got done. The only negative was I could hear a slight whine when the drive was in gear. I need to check the engine alignment again now that it has been run a little. Hopefully not a dig deal, but I don't have much room to raise the engine on the mounts.
